Mo-Ranch Outdoor Adventure Day Camp strives to provide your child with a safe and fun-filled experience. We also work hard to provide parents peace of mind knowing your children will be under the care and supervision of trained Counselors. Amber Thomas, Day Camp Director, has been in the camping industry since 1997. Amber first came to Mo-Ranch in 1990 as a summer retreat participant, and, beginning in 2006, she joined the staff as a facilitator for the Environmental Leadership Program and the Assistant Director for the Summer Camp. After moving to Iowa for a year and a half, Amber returned to Mo-Ranch where she loves acquainting children with the natural world around them-in creative and fun ways! Amber holds certifications in American Red Cross Emergency Response, CPR, Lifeguarding, and is a certified Challenge Course Manager. In addition, Amber is a Standards Visitor for the American Camping Association (ACA), completed the ACA Basic Camp Director Course, and is an ACA Conference Presenter.
Additional Day Camp Counselors will be assisting Amber. These Counselors are selected for their friendliness, their sense of responsibility, their maturity and their character. Counselors will receive specific training in areas such as child behavior management, age level expectations, safety and emergency procedures, as well as certifications in First Aid, CPR and Lifeguarding. Certified Lifeguards will be on duty during all aquatic activities and a Camp Health Manager will be on site and available in case of illness or injury.
